Economy 10 tariffs are electricity tariffs that give you ten hours of cheaper electricity a day. Generally speaking these Economy 10 tariffs will give you seven hours of cheaper electricity at night and three hours of cheaper electricity during the day.How do I know if I have economy 10?
Look at your electricity meterAn Economy 10 meter will have two sets of numbers, one labelled “low” and one labelled “normal.” If you see these sets of numbers on your meter, you have a multi-rate meter, which indicates either Economy 10 or Economy 7.
What is the difference between Economy 7 and 10?
How Is Economy 10 different from Economy 7? The key difference is simply the number of off-peak hours. While Economy 7 offers you seven hours of off-peak energy at night only, Economy 10 adds three day-time hours, usually in the afternoon. What are the Economy 7 times? The off-peak electricity times for your E7 meter will vary depending on where you live and who your provider is. Usually you get your seven hours of off-peak electricity sometime between 11pm and 8am. This might be split up into chunks of time.How do I know if I have an Economy 7 or 10 meter?
You can tell you have an Economy 7 (or an Economy 10) meter because it shows two sets of numbers, rather than a single reading. This will be displayed in one of two ways: Two sets of numbers, one marked “low” (the night-time rate) and one marked “normal” (the standard, daytime rate)How do I read my Economy 10 meter?
How to read an Economy 10 meter
- Write down the numbers left to right, including any zeros.
- Ignore any numbers in red (or the odd colour) or after the decimal point.
- Make a note of which reading is for the day (Rate 1) and the night (Rate 2).

Economy 7 is good if you have storage heatersThey consume masses of electricity. That's why using them when it's cheaper is critical if you're on Economy 7. If you use one on an expensive normal tariff, it could be dear. If you don't have storage heating, Economy 7 isn't worth it in most cases.

Does a clothes dryer use a lot of electricity?
Electric clothes dryers use anywhere from 1800 to 5000 watts of energy, on average, dependent on the load and cycle configurations. This equates to about 1.8 to 5 kWh of electricity. Whirlpool dryers typically require 2100 watts of energy.
